Web26 de abr. de 2024 · The VG-10 is hunting-grade stainless steel produced in Japan and the steel is mostly used for making high-quality hunting knives. The VG-10 stands for (V Gold) which means quality. It’s stainless and its high carbon content of 1% carbon, 1% Molybdenum, 15% Chromium, 0.2% of Vanadium, and 1.5% of cobalt.
